我在/usr/local/bin钻了个洞。运行which drush将返回/usr/local/bin/drush。但是,运行drush会显示"-bash: /usr/bin/drush: No such file or directory“。运行/usr/local/bin/drush是正确的。
我的$PATH是/usr/local/bin:/usr/local/mysql/bin:/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/opt/X11/bin
在出现此问题之前添加了一个编辑,我删除了位于/usr/bin/drush的脚本的副本。它
环境- Windows 7企业(Service Pack 1)
流程
已安装git
配置了用于git的user.name和user.email
安装nodejs
node version - 8.11.3
npm version - 6.4.0
安装Python2.7.3
added environement variable and updated path statement
安装Visual 2015社区版本
installed Visual C== 2015 Tools for Windows Desktop
installed Windows XP Support for C++
我有一张桌子,像这样:
id name1 name2 name3
1 yok null null
1 null yok null
1 null null yok
我想要的输出是:
id name1 name2 name3
1 yok yok yok
我尝试的是:
select id, name1, name2, name3
from trial
group by id
建表脚本如下:
Create table trial (id int, name1 varchar(10),name2
我正在从mysql数据库中提取一些数据,并用它构建一个表。我有一个截断函数,可以截断很长的字符串。
下面是截断函数:
function myTruncate($string, $limit, $break=".", $pad="...")
{
// return with no change if string is shorter than $limit
if(strlen($string) <= $limit) return $string;
// is $break present between
我的站点使用MySQL DB,它托管在上。
我编写了一个测试脚本,我使用“mysql”运行它来测试事务是否正常。运行脚本时,我不会收到任何错误,但是执行脚本的结果就好像没有启用事务一样。
我还确保将所有特权授予运行脚本的admin MySQL用户。
为了进行双重检查,我在PostgreSQL上尝试了相同的测试脚本,在那里--脚本的结果表明事务确实工作。所以这绝对是MySQL特有的东西。
脚本运行在我创建的一个简单表上,如下所示:
create table a ( id serial primary key);
以下是测试脚本:
delete from a;
set autocommit = 0